Susan Feniger
Susan Feniger is a renowned American chef, restaurateur, cookbook author, and radio and TV personality. She is best known for her innovative and influential role in the culinary world, particularly in the realm of global cuisine.
Early Life and Education
Susan Feniger was born and raised in Toledo, Ohio. She developed a passion for cooking at a young age, which led her to pursue a career in the culinary arts. She attended the Culinary Institute of America, where she honed her skills and developed a deep understanding of the culinary arts.
Career
After graduating from the Culinary Institute of America, Feniger moved to France to further her culinary education. Upon returning to the United States, she worked in various restaurants before opening her own, City Cafe, in Los Angeles in 1981. The success of City Cafe led to the opening of Border Grill, a Mexican restaurant that she co-owns with her long-time business partner, Mary Sue Milliken.
Feniger and Milliken's partnership extended beyond Border Grill. They co-authored several cookbooks and co-hosted the Food Network show, Too Hot Tamales. They also opened several other restaurants, including Cantina, Ciudad, and Street, each offering a unique take on global cuisine.
Personal Life
Feniger is openly gay and has been a long-time advocate for LGBTQ+ rights. She is also involved in various charitable organizations, including the Los Angeles LGBT Center and Scleroderma Research Foundation.
Recognition
Throughout her career, Feniger has received numerous awards and accolades for her contributions to the culinary world. She was awarded the Julia Child Award in 2018, and she and Milliken were the first women to receive the James Beard Foundation's Outstanding Restaurateur Award.
